AQI acquires Dalma Energy

Dubai, March 25, 2008

The ownership of Dalma Energy and its subsidiary has been transferred to Al Qahtani Investments (AQI).

Aabar, listed on the Abu Dhabi stock exchange, and Dalma’s previous holding company have signed an agreement with GulfCap Group Limited.

GulfCap has subsequently signed an agreement with AQI novating the original agreement. The acquisition of Dalma was completed during the first week of January 2008.

“We see this acquisition as a strategic long term investment for Al-Qahtani Group, being in line with our interests in both domestic and international markets. It is our intention to develop Dalma Energy into one of the leading drilling and services companies in the region,” said Al Qahtani Investments Chairman Shaikh Tariq Al Qahtani.

“Al Nasser Group is keen to diversify its portfolio in the oil field services. The acquisition of Dalma will help to expand our oil field services further. We see tremendous synergies between Dalma and our existing business in the oil and gas sector,” said Al Qahtani Investments director Abdulla Nasser.

Dalma operates 22 land drilling rigs in Oman, Saudi Arabia, Qatar, India and Algeria. The company’s fleet comprises of seven light rigs of less than 1,000 horsepower (hp), 4 medium rigs of 1,500 hp, and 11 heavy rigs of 2,000 hp.

The company offers a variety of services from shallow depth drilling and work over operations to drilling oil wells and deep gas wells in excess of 5,000 meters.

“We are happy to have initiated this transaction, and are grateful to all the shareholders of Al Qahtani Investments who joined hands in acquiring Dalma Energy. Our vision is to transform Dalma, which is presently a regional drilling company, into an international integrated oil services company,” said GulfCap Group CEO and Al-Qahtani Investments director Suleiman Shahbal. – TradeArabia News Service
